1.项目 2.给Integer最大值+1,是什么结果(溢出) 3ArrayList和LinkedList区别 4.HashMap和TreeMap区别 5.HashMap存放元素流程 6.为什么HashMap采用红黑树? 7.HashCode和equals方法关系?两个对象的equals相等hashcode不相等会发生什么? 8.面向对象和面向过程的区别? 9.多态? 10.StringBuilde
自我介绍 项目介绍(面试官不感兴趣,项目里用到的redis、mq、分布式,一点没问) synchronize 方法 和 代码块的区别 Sychronize 的原理和优化措施 1.8 ConcurrentHashMap将lock改为cas + synchornize的原因,优化思路 concurrentHashMap扩容问题 为什么链表长度超过8就要转化为红黑树,为什么是8 红黑树和链表的查找效率问
自我介绍 最长回文字子串 进程与线程的区别 java序列化 sql学生表,得到排名前三的学生 说一下聚合函数的关键字 TCP三次握手,为什么不两次握手 了解哪些测试方法(等价类划分,边界值分析) 说一下等价类划分法 微信点赞测试用例 如果研发bug太多的话怎么办(bug不严重的话赶快解决保证上线,严重的话只能推迟上线,不会大,瞎说的) 了解过哪些测试工具(Selenium,说一下具体是干啥的:做自
自我介绍 在校经历 项目没咋问全是八股 tcp/udp区别 为什么三次握手 进程之间切换 Linux系统命令(一点不会) 对操作系统的理解 gc 死锁 什么时候用redis redis的基本数据类型 ioc和aop spring有哪些模块 spring的注释有哪些分别怎么用 做题 数据库查询 中序遍历二叉树,不用递归 智力题3L和7L的杯子平分10L水 反问 感觉要寄
自我介绍 介绍项目(介绍了实验室项目) 再介绍一个能体现自己能力的项目(介绍了实习项目) 算法题: 复原ip地址(A了) 数组中和 ≥ target 的长度最小的连续子数组(双指针,A了) 反问: 后续流程推进要多久? 没有安全背景的如何培养?
问项目20min map flatmap区别 哈希冲突解决 数据库怎么优化 30分钟问完 写题 LRU 碰到KPI了
一开始麦没声音重启后才弄好导致面试官多等了几分钟 1. 上来先做题:给一个多层嵌套的数组,要求实现Array.prototype.getLevel()方法得到数组最深嵌套的层数(遍历元素然后记录下最大嵌套层数) 2. 判断数组有哪些方法(Array.isArray(),instanceof,Object.prototype.toString.call(),constructor) 3. Promi
一面:1.简历项目 2. 考察数组的基本方法, 哪些方法会改动原数组哪些不会 3. 一道递归遍历对象手撕题 function fn(tree, name){ // 请在这里实现 if(tree.name == name){ return tree; } let ans = null; if(tree.children && tree.childr
自我介绍 讲一个重要的项目,针对项目提问。 sql题 Python题(面的时候没想出来,面完就知道怎么写了,服了😅) 反问 一共35min,这不是纯纯kpi吗 #数分# #秋招#
一面 8.14 自我介绍 实习内容,没有深挖 Hive 的存储格式 orc parquet 有没有了解过Cube, grouping sets 有没有了解过 group by ,sort by,cluster by ,distribute by 的区别 Mr的工作流程 Yarn的调度框架 Hive内部表外部表区别 Lag lead first_value last_value含义 Row_numb
1. 自我介绍 2. 深挖研究经历 3. 项目进行了单元测试,那单元测试覆盖率多少?case? 4. 项目有没有进行压测?最大并发量、压测相关指标 5. 除了接口测试、性能测试、单元测试外,还知道哪些测试? 6. 项目中有设计登陆模块吗? 7. 项目使用的什么协议?那https比http好在哪里? 8. 为什么使用Websokcet进行页面与服务器通信?使用http不行吗? 9. 使用乐观锁会不会
手子真好,流程挺快的,不拖泥带水,好评😁 一面(30min)(8.11): 全程聊实习项目,无八股,无手撕算法。 速通,隔了一个小时约二面,有点惊到我了,比面试评价来的都快。 二面(1h)(8.15): 1、项目介绍,逐个项目讲解 2、八股:计算机网络,osi模型,模型各层功能介绍,排序算法,各个排序算法怎么实现,复杂度怎么样。 3、算法题:leetcode搜索二维矩阵,二分查找 追问:有没有其
没想到有二面,但是只面了30分钟 1.自我介绍 2.问了下论文,面试管也懂深度学习 3.做题 链表删除倒数第n个节点 自己写测试用例,输入输出,链表也要自己建(力扣刷多了,都快不会了,墨迹了10来分钟) 4.反问 我问了下快手测开部门做的什么业务,面试管说 电商,还是需要一点工程能力的 没了,30分钟,两个问题结束 #快手测开面经#
面试官人特别特别随和,甚至提前上线(碰巧我进了面试,在厕所蹲坑),全程欢声笑语,希望秋招都是这样的面试官 项目/经历深挖 lambda表达式 LC 56 区间合并 LC 72 编辑距离 反问
50min 大部分问的基础 很多手写题 1 手写一个new() 2 原型链 Object.create(null) {} 区别 结合题目说原型指向 3 说说this指向 4 事件循环机制题目 5 nexttick题目 (面试官提示了差点答错了) 6 项目优化 7 手写防抖 8 手写两个有序数组的并集 反问 技术栈和业务用的react和原生js,说不会卡vue,但是感觉有点寄 更新 早上11点面下午